Subject: Log compaction rollout — Ferrowick queue

Hi all, especially folks who joined this quarter: we're enabling log compaction on the Ferrowick message queue tonight. Compaction keeps only the latest record per key, so consumers that replay full history will see gaps — this is expected and documented in the onboarding wiki. Staging ran compacted for two weeks with no issues. If your service replays topics, test against staging before Thursday. The rollout ships under the release identified below.

trace token, kawip-fafog: htk14_26e64c4d35154e

Q: Why are we only seeing a fraction of Burrowcast's logs?

A: Because it's chatty — we sample. Info-level lines are kept at 5%, warnings at 50%, errors always. Sampling is per-request, so a kept request keeps all its lines; traces stay coherent. Need full volume for a repro? Flip the debug flag for an hour, tops. Sampling config and the override process are on the internal page below.

wiki page, fajof-tajef: https://vault.tolvaqio.corp/board/pipeline/pages/ticket/c20d7f984bcc9e12

## Releases

Quick note for the sync: the nightly search reindex on Mossgate now ships as its own release artifact instead of piggybacking on the API deploy. It runs at 01:30, takes ~20 minutes, and rolls back automatically on checksum mismatch. Artifacts must be signed before the runner will touch them. The key we sign reindex artifacts with is below.

release key, bagep-yajof: bky19_xtqFhCW5hRYj5CXT2ZJ

## EXIF Scrub Runbook (Opaline Uploads)

All inbound images pass through the Opaline scrubber before storage. It strips EXIF, GPS, and maker notes. Never bypass it, even for internal uploads. If the queue backs up, scale workers — do not disable scrubbing. Failures land in the quarantine bucket for review. The scrubber runs with these configuration values.

deployment values, bagag-bawig:
DRUVAN_PIN=0740
DRUVAN_TENANT=wendor
DRUVAN_METRICS_HOST=metrics.druvan.tolvaqnet.example
DRUVAN_SEAL=seal_75cd0b2d
DRUVAN_STANDBY_TEAM=tamael